Auctex automatically bibtex download

Other modes may have a similar feature, or one could always set filelocal variables through spc f v f you can also customize which program is used to display the pdfs. This is normal the basic auctex work flow requires that you run the various compilation steps one at a time. Using graphics in the multicolumn environment by anita schwartz, consultant for personal tex, inc. Bib2x the bibtex converter bibtex to anything converter, using a flexible and powerful template language.

It helps the users for editing the documents to markup level. Id like to download automatically tons of papers listed on. I have bibtex files with thousands of entries and ive found bibtex reftex good enough to manage them. Menu items allow you to change or delete matching pairs of brackets, as well as insert \left\right automatically. You can group entries explicitly, by keywords or any other fields. It performs searches and downloads articles assuming they are open. Referencer referencer is a gnome application to organise documents or references, and ultimately generate a bibtex bibliography file. It took me a while to figure out how to generate footnotes automatically, because the sources i found on the internet, didnt mention this at all. Jabref is an open source bibliography reference manager.

Change the name to auctex by using the windows explorer or by typing rename auctex9. Jabref entries will automatically create a bibtex citation key in the manner. Top 4 download periodically updates software information of bibtex full versions from the publishers, but some information may be slightly outofdate using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for bibtex license key is illegal. You on the contrary try to typeset a bibliography manually. The bibtex tool is typically used together with the latex document preparation system. Suggestion for \cite in emacs with auctex stack overflow. Do not try to use the auc t e x package with another version or distribution of emacs. Jul 23, 2019 bibtex, biblatex and biber makeindex, nomenclature, glossaries and acronyms conversion tools viewers for pdf, ps, and dvi xetex others. Jabref can be instructed to search for the full text of a reference, download it, and directly link it to the bibtex entry. The word,bibtex stands for a tool and a file format which are used to describe and process lists of references, mostly in conjunction with latex documents. Jabref installed on your computer, download it from this website. It looks like doom uses the package pdftools and auctex but i would recommend just using spacemacs defaults.

Very handy framework to use bibtex with different word processors. This project wont be successful without contributions from the community, especially the current and past key contributors. Also, get reftex, which is like a bridge between bibtex and auctex. Bib t e x allows the user to store his citation data in generic form, while printing citations in a document in the form specified by a bib t e x style, to be specified in the document itself one often needs a l a t e x citationstyle package, such as natbib as well bib t e x itself is an asciionly program. Jabref can be instructed to search for the full text of a. I dont know why it doesnt do the same thing for the \cite macro, but you can add the behaviour by setting reftex. Or compile directly from your ide, for example in gnuemacs use cc to compile. Qiqqa qiqqa is a free research manager that has builtin support for automatically associating bibtex records with your pdfs and a bibtex sniffer for helping you semi automatically find bibtex records. I go to the ref menu customize browse reftex group reftex citacion support reftex default bibliography and then i add the path to the bib file without the.

The format is entirely character based, so it can be used by any program although the standard. Bibtex is a program that reads entries from a database of citations based on the. I have this code in my private config to enable automatically compiling the latex and refreshing the pdf when. The name is a portmanteau of the word bibliography and the name of. In this post, i will share my customization and introduce some academic tools i use with emacs. Bibtex introduction this is the first draft of this document. To compile your latex documents in a dos window cmd or command, use the line. Use mendeley to create citations using latex and bibtex. You can do this by inserting setqdefault texmaster nil automatically insert \. Yes, modifying this variable is a solution i dont know if it is the best solution. Certain modes, such as latexmode with auctex, will automatically lookup references in a document if any of the recognized bibliography commands are used. Aug 21, 2019 the customization of emacs as an academic integrated platform. Looks like you want companyauctex and perhaps force parsing of all reerence sources. Heres where the cool and the only complicated part is.

This usually means unpacking it at the desired place. Multifile documents multifile documents are fully supported. Let me present you a list of free latex editors for windows. I bound cx c to ivybibtex, then i start typing the author name, or title or date, then, when the wanted reference appears i. How can i generate references automatically in overleaf. Latex editors decision guidance auctex kile led lyx scientific wordworkplace texmaker and texstudio texniccenter announcements. Change the name to auctex by using the windows explorer or by typing rename auctex 9. Latex distributions decision guidance miktex and protext tex live and mactex others.

The word, bibtex stands for a tool and a file format which are used to describe and process lists of references, mostly in conjunction with latex documents. Here you will find everything you need to know about bibtex. In this tutorial, i am going to share with you a list of top best latex editors for linux and how to install those. While it is easy to download and copy bibliographic entries to your database, these. There are great resources online to learn latex, such as this one. Are there any tools to automatically search and download. Youre editing the raw text, but the commands for navigation, manipulation and cleanup are powerful enough that you wont miss the fancier graphical apps. However, what i really wanted to show you is how to add citations using latex and your automatically generated bibtex file. These latex editors provide you sophisticated environment to create texlatex documents, without an hassle. Get everything done for a latexfile with the elisp function textexify which gets this job done. It seems you did not test your code snippet and checked whether its working at all.

Automatic creation of entry keys using the functionality of emacs. Reference management, bibliography management, citations and a whole lot more. I generally agree with tikhon that auctex is very powerful. When the enclosing macro is \cite or \ref and no other message occupies the echo area, information about the citation or label will automatically be displayed in the echo area. Bib2x is free software, licensed under the terms of the gpl v2.

I use doomemacs but im certain something very similar could be recreated using spacemacs. They both share the same generic backend, bibtexcompletion, but one. I bound cx c to ivybibtex, then i start typing the author name, or title or date, then, when the wanted reference appears i just hit ret and its done. In the following image, you can see an example latex file. Bibtex, biblatex and biber makeindex, nomenclature, glossaries and acronyms conversion tools viewers for pdf, ps, and dvi xetex others. The customization of emacs as an academic integrated platform. Feb 05, 2014 i generally agree with tikhon that auctex is very powerful. Jabref latex and bibtex library guides at university of. Helmbibtex and ivybibtex allow you to search and manage your bibtex bibliography. Bibtex software free download bibtex top 4 download. Is there an easy way to sort the references automatically, even if every time i add new references at the bottom. Ebib is a program for managing bibtex and biblatex databases that runs inside emacs. Latexbibliography management wikibooks, open books for an. Within the typesetting system, its name is styled as.

The instructions provided with each release of auctex describe how to build and install the software so that auctex will automatically be invoked when you edit a file with a name ending in. The latter is slower and larger the download size of the base system is about 15 mb. Apr 14, 2019 looks like you want companyauctex and perhaps force parsing of all reerence sources. After opening a tex file, the first time i try to use the autocompletion of the \cite command, i get cite.

Powerful and well documented tool to manipulate bibtex databases. Wibtex is a fast, handy, and easytouse database application that allows you to manage your references to books, articles and other texts be in printed or electronic form. Download links are directly from our mirrors or publishers website. Choose the package auctex with key i and press x to start the installation. The first time you run it, it will call latex on your file, or whatever option you have set for texengine i. Inserting references and cite them using ivy bibtex. Latex workshop is an extension for visual studio code, aiming to provide core features for latex typesetting with visual studio code.

I manage my references with zotero which generates a. There is a mailing list for general discussion about auctex. It also has a sibling extension, latex utilities, providing extra features. Bibtex is reference management software for formatting lists of references.

I dont know why it doesnt do the same thing for the \cite macro, but you can add the behaviour by setting reftex formatcitefunction. Back in the 1980s and 1990s bibtex users had little choice but to create bib entries from scratch. Designed by academics for academics, under continuous development since 2003, and used by both individuals and major research institutions worldwide, wikindx is a single or multiuser virtual research environment an enhanced online bibliography manager storing searchable references, notes, files, citations, ideas. If there is no other kind of text processing or editing that you do other than writing papers, then i think its a harder sell to learn emacs, honestly. Automatically insert nonbreaking space before citation reftex automatically inserts a tilde before the \ref macro if its needed, i.

This is done through the texcommandmaster command, bound to cc cc. To run latex and bibtex on a document one has to press cc cc multiple times. Jabref an open source bibliography reference manager bibtool powerful and well documented tool to manipulate bibtex databases. The order of the citation in the text is not right. It provides export and import features fromto bibtex as well as automatic and. I use emacs for almost everything i do with my laptop, such as notetaking, gtd, emailchecking, coding and writing. Im using using auctex to write a ieeetrans latex document with a seperate bibtex file.

Furthermore it is unclear where this references environment comes from. I split the frame into 2 windows with my latex on the left and the pdf on the right. Bibtex is an application and a bibliography file format written by oren patashnik and leslie lamport for the latex document preparation system. To have easier access to the following configurations, you may download my emacs configuration file with right click and save link as. As i recall i used to simply hit cc cc currently bound to texcommandmaster repeatedly until it said view in the minibuffer, and then auctex would have taken care of running pdflatex and bibtex as needed ive now moved to a new machine still same os linux mint 17. If you think auctex is already installed on your system because the emacs info page for it is present, for example, ask your system administrator. Other modes may have a similar feature, or one could always set filelocal variables through spc f v f. In the arena of linux, latex is considered as a standard markup language. Here you can learn about the bibtex file format, how to use bibtex and bibtex tools which can help you to ease your bibtex usage. I think the biggest advantage of emacs is that it can edit all text, including latex, source code, raw text documents, etc.

There are lots of best latex editor available for linux, but it seems difficult to choose the best latex editor for both advanced and beginner. Once thats done, you may need to rerun it to have your bibliography compiled. If you want to download the source, you can clone the git repository for ebib. Auctex automatically indents your latexsource, not only as you write it. It seems you have to manually put the references at the correct position, then the numbering will be correct. Automatic sorting of bibliography entries only works with bibtex. A subreddit for the timeless and infinitely powerful editor. It is being widely used for preparation of documents in many fields, such as science, maths, physics, statistics, etc. I have bibtex files with thousands of entries and ive found bibtexreftex good enough to manage them.

780 1347 605 133 1560 663 1048 1174 120 1362 901 51 1388 1117 329 18 274 165 464 330 613 1210 1514 578 1483 1148 1374 143 1428 890 895 945 1095 1430 286 299 51